news 2026/5/15 11:53:04

基于STM32单片机智能浇花 WIFI传输 光照补偿 温度 土壤湿度 声光报警 风扇降温

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
基于STM32单片机智能浇花 WIFI传输 光照补偿 温度 土壤湿度 声光报警 风扇降温

目录

      • STM32单片机智能浇花系统概述
      • 核心功能模块
      • 硬件设计要点
      • 软件逻辑流程
      • 应用场景
    • 源码文档获取/同行可拿货,招校园代理 :文章底部获取博主联系方式!

STM32单片机智能浇花系统概述

该系统基于STM32单片机设计,集成WIFI传输、光照补偿、温湿度监测、声光报警及风扇降温功能,实现自动化植物养护。

核心功能模块

WIFI数据传输
通过ESP8266等WIFI模块与云端或手机APP通信,实时上传土壤湿度、温度、光照数据,支持远程控制浇水、风扇开关等操作。

环境参数监测

  • 土壤湿度检测:采用电阻式或电容式传感器,检测土壤含水量,触发阈值自动灌溉。
  • 温度监测:DS18B20或DHT11传感器实时采集环境温度,数据用于风扇控制逻辑。
  • 光照补偿:光敏电阻或BH1750传感器检测光照强度,配合LED补光灯实现光照不足时自动补光。

智能控制与报警

  • 自动浇水:继电器控制水泵,根据土壤湿度阈值启动/停止浇水。
  • 风扇降温:温度超过设定值时启动风扇,降低环境温度。
  • 声光报警:蜂鸣器与LED灯组合报警,提示土壤过干、温度过高或系统异常。

硬件设计要点

  • 主控芯片:STM32F103C8T6,处理传感器数据并执行控制逻辑。
  • 电源管理:采用5V/3.3V稳压电路,确保传感器与模块稳定供电。
  • 外围电路:包括传感器信号调理电路、继电器驱动电路等。

软件逻辑流程

  1. 初始化传感器与WIFI模块,建立网络连接。
  2. 循环采集环境数据,通过WIFI上传至服务器。
  3. 判断土壤湿度、温度、光照是否超阈值,触发相应控制动作。
  4. 异常状态时启动声光报警,并通过WIFI推送通知。

应用场景

适用于家庭盆栽、温室大棚等场景,解决传统浇水不精准、环境调控滞后问题,提升植物存活率与生长效率。

注:具体实现需结合硬件选型与代码开发,建议参考STM32 HAL库或Arduino兼容框架进行快速原型设计。






源码文档获取/同行可拿货,招校园代理 :文章底部获取博主联系方式!

需要成品或者定制,加我们的时候,不满意的可以定制
文章最下方名片联系我即可~

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/9 3:34:43

YOLOv10官方镜像支持FP16加速,显存占用降40%

YOLOv10官方镜像支持FP16加速,显存占用降40% 当工业视觉系统在毫秒级响应中争分夺秒,当边缘设备在有限显存里反复权衡模型大小与检测精度,一个被开发者反复追问的问题终于有了确定答案:YOLOv10能不能真正“轻装上阵”&#xff0c…

作者头像 李华
网站建设 2026/5/10 14:17:01

电源管理硬件调试:实战案例解决上电复位异常问题

以下是对您提供的博文内容进行 深度润色与结构重构后的专业级技术文章 。全文已彻底去除AI痕迹,采用真实硬件工程师口吻写作,逻辑层层递进、语言简洁有力、案例具象可感,兼具教学性、实战性与思想深度。文中所有技术细节均严格基于原始材料…

作者头像 李华
网站建设 2026/5/11 11:08:54

无需Prompt技巧:InstructPix2Pix魔法修图师中文用户实操手册

无需Prompt技巧:InstructPix2Pix魔法修图师中文用户实操手册 1. 这不是滤镜,是会听指令的修图师 你有没有过这样的时刻: 想把一张旅行照里的阴天改成晴空万里,却卡在PS图层蒙版里反复调试; 想给朋友合影加一副复古圆…

作者头像 李华
网站建设 2026/5/12 17:05:46

Z-Image-Turbo中文生图实测,文字融合自然不违和

Z-Image-Turbo中文生图实测,文字融合自然不违和 你有没有试过让AI画一张带中文的海报,结果字不是歪的、就是糊的、要么干脆拼错成“牛马”变“牛馬”?又或者提示词里写了“水墨江南”,生成的却是欧式教堂配霓虹灯?这类…

作者头像 李华
网站建设 2026/5/12 3:40:23

ChatGLM3-6B-128K开箱体验:一键部署+功能全解析

ChatGLM3-6B-128K开箱体验:一键部署功能全解析 1. 为什么需要一个“能读万字长文”的6B模型? 你有没有遇到过这些场景: 把一份30页的PDF技术白皮书拖进对话框,模型刚读到第5页就忘了开头讲了什么;给客服系统喂入整套…

作者头像 李华